drip edge ✔✔Metal flashing applied to the edges of a roof to prevent water from
infiltrating beneath the protective roof membrane and to direct rainwater into the rain
gutters.

balusters and spacing ✔✔spacing no more than 4 3/4 inches, used to support hand rails
stair handrails ✔✔betwen 34 and 38 inches high
stair tread ✔✔width of stair minimun of 10 inches
Stair Riser ✔✔height of stair- can not be more than 7 and 3/4 inches high, can't vary
more than 3/8th in size throughout stairs
open stair riser ✔✔if more than 4 inches high it can not be open
gable roof ✔✔A pitched roof with two sloped sides (most common)
Gambrel Roof ✔✔A curb roof, having a steep lower slope with a flatter upper slope
above. (barn roof)
shed roof ✔✔slopes to one side
hipped roof ✔✔A roof with four sloped sides. The sides meet at a ridge at the center of
the roof.
